- 1. _I_n_t_r_o_d_u_c_t_i_o_n
-
- These notes describe the Base Development (_d_e_v) of the 6.5
- IRIS Developer's Option from Silicon Graphicsr, Inc. They
- include discussion of _m_a_k_e(1), header files, libraries, the
- kernel, and device drivers.

- 1.2 _O_n_l_i_n_e__R_e_l_e_a_s_e__N_o_t_e_s
-
- After you install the online documentation for a product
- (the _r_e_l_n_o_t_e_s subsystem), you can view the release notes on
- your screen.
-
- If you have a graphics system, select ``Release Notes'' from
- the Tools submenu of the Toolchest. This displays the
- _g_r_e_l_n_o_t_e_s(1) graphical browser for the online release notes.

- Refer to the _g_r_e_l_n_o_t_e_s(1) man page for information on
- options to this command.
-
- If you have a nongraphics system, you can use the _r_e_l_n_o_t_e_s
- command. Refer to the _r_e_l_n_o_t_e_s(1) man page for accessing
- the online release notes.
